Learn C# Help

Object

É um tipo de dado genérico que pode aceitar qualquer tipo de valor ou objeto

Usado para por exemplo quando não sabe o tipo da informação ou ela é de varios tipos diferentes

object obj = 10; obj = "Hello World";

Boxing and Unboxing

Boxing: Converte um tipo primitivo em object.

  • Exemplo:

int i = 5; // Tipo primitivo int object obj = i; // Boxing, converte o tipo int em object

Unboxing: Converte um object em um tipo primitivo.

  • Exemplo:

object obj = 5; // Objeto do tipo object com valor inteiro int i = (int)obj; // Unboxing, converte o objeto em um tipo primitivo int
10 July 2025